Every Knee Will Bow — Today in Light of Eternity
“It is written: ‘As surely as I live,’ says the Lord, ‘every knee will bow before me; every tongue will acknowledge God.’” — Romans 14:11

Unpacking the Message of Romans 14:11
Romans 14:11 carries a weight and authority that few verses express with such clarity. It is a declaration, a promise, and a revelation of God’s ultimate sovereignty. When Paul writes, “It is written: ‘As surely as I live,’ says the Lord, ‘every knee will bow before me; every tongue will acknowledge God,’” he is quoting the Old Testament and reminding believers of a truth that transcends time. This is not merely a theological statement—it is a reality that reshapes how we live, think, worship, and treat others.
This verse reveals that God’s sovereignty is not up for debate. It is not dependent on human belief, cultural acceptance, or the shifting tides of opinion. God is God, regardless of who recognizes Him in this life. Every knee bowing and every tongue confessing is not a suggestion but an inevitable moment in history. The certainty of it is anchored in God’s own declaration: “As surely as I live.” There is no higher guarantee.
The One who cannot lie, cannot fail, and cannot be dethroned declares that all creation will one day acknowledge Him. This truth brings both comfort and conviction. For the believer, it reassures us that we serve the One who reigns above all earthly chaos. For the world, it is a sobering reminder that rejecting Him now does not change the reality of His ultimate authority.
This verse also speaks to the universality of God’s rule. Every knee means every person—rich and poor, powerful and powerless, believer and unbeliever, every nation, every culture, every background. No one is outside the reach or authority of God’s kingship. This universal acknowledgment points to a moment when all illusions of independence or self-sufficiency will melt away. Human pride, rebellion, and self-exaltation will be confronted with the undeniable glory of God. The greatest kings and the most hardened skeptics will bow alongside the humble and the faithful. When the glory of God is revealed in its fullness, no human heart will be able to deny it.
This truth has profound implications for how we live in the present. If every tongue will one day acknowledge God, then our confession of Him now becomes an act of joyful surrender rather than forced submission. Worship becomes voluntary, not compulsory. Following Christ becomes a chosen devotion rather than a future inevitability. The wise person chooses now what every person will eventually be compelled to do: recognize God’s authority and give Him the honor He deserves. This verse is an invitation to live on the right side of eternity today, not later.
Understanding the inevitability of God’s final victory also helps us navigate the tension between earthly pressures and heavenly truth. There are moments when the world mocks righteousness, suppresses truth, or elevates man’s opinion above God’s Word.
But Romans 14:11 tells us that these cultural trends do not change God’s throne. He is not shaken by disbelief. His sovereignty does not waver when people deny Him. The day is coming when truth will stand fully revealed, and those who clung to God in faith will see that they placed their trust in the eternal, immovable Rock. This strengthens our resolve to live boldly, speak truthfully, and persevere faithfully—even when the world goes a different direction.

This verse also shapes how we treat others. Earlier in Romans 14, Paul addresses believers who are judging one another over disputable matters. His reminder that everyone will stand before God seems to say, “Stop trying to be the judge—there is already a Judge.” When we remember that every person will answer before God, we are freed from the burden of trying to control or condemn others. Instead, we can walk in humility, grace, and unity. We recognize that God alone sees the heart, God alone knows motives, and God alone is worthy of judgment and honor. This truth humbles us and softens our posture toward others.
Romans 14:11 also calls us to live in reverent awe. The thought of every knee bowing should stir our hearts, not with fear, but with worship. It reminds us of God’s majesty, His holiness, His unchallenged dominion. When we picture that moment—every person, past and present, collapsing before the majesty of the King—it helps us see God more clearly in our daily lives. The God we pray to is the same God who will one day command universal acknowledgment. The God we serve is the same God before whom every earthly authority will one day fall silent.
This verse further challenges us to examine our lives. If every tongue will confess God’s authority, are we confessing Him now in the way we live? Are our decisions shaped by His Word? Do our words honor Him? Do our actions reflect a life already bowed before Him? This is not about perfection but about posture—the posture of a heart surrendered willingly to God. When we voluntarily bow now, we experience a peace, purpose, and power unknown to those who resist His Lordship.
Romans 14:11 also inspires confidence in God’s justice. Many believers wrestle with questions about wickedness going unpunished or evil appearing to triumph. But this verse reassures us that God will have the last word. Every injustice, every act of rebellion, every proud word spoken against God will be brought into the light. No sin will escape His judgment, and no righteousness will go unrewarded. This gives us courage to live with integrity even when no one sees, because God sees. And He will judge every knee—not by human standards, but by His perfect holiness.
Finally, this verse helps anchor our hope. The world is unstable, unpredictable, and filled with voices competing for authority. But Romans 14:11 reminds us that there is only one true authority, one ultimate King, one unshakable throne. When we live in the reality of God’s kingdom, we are not swayed by fear, pressure, or uncertainty. We are rooted in the truth that God reigns, God rules, and God will be acknowledged by all. That reality gives us strength to endure, courage to stand firm, and joy to worship in every season.
The message of Romans 14:11 is not meant to intimidate believers—it is meant to fortify them. It reminds us that our faith is not built on wishful thinking but on divine certainty. The God we trust now will one day be recognized by all. And the life we live now in obedience and devotion is not wasted—it is aligned with the ultimate truth of eternity. When we bow now, we live as people who understand what is coming. And when we acknowledge Him now, we join the eternal chorus ahead of time.

Here is our complete 7-day journaling plan for Romans 14:11 — each day includes a prompt, opening prayer, and closing prayer. The prayers are short, peaceful, and consistent in tone to frame each journaling time beautifully...
Living daily in the reality of God’s authority - “It is written: ‘As surely as I live,’ says the Lord, ‘every knee will bow before me; every tongue will acknowledge God.’” — Romans 14:11
Day 1 — The Certainty of God’s Sovereignty
Opening Prayer: Lord, still my heart as I sit with You. Help me see Your sovereignty clearly today and surrender myself fully to Your reign. Amen.
Journal Prompt: Reflect on what God’s sovereignty means to you personally. How does knowing that every knee will one day bow shape your faith, your decisions, and your perspective?
Closing Prayer: Father, thank You for reminding me that You reign over all things. Help me walk today with a heart aligned to Your authority. Amen.
Day 2 — Surrender vs. Acknowledgment
Opening Prayer: Heavenly Lord, open my heart to choose You freely today—not out of pressure, but out of love and reverence. Amen.
Journal Prompt: What areas of your life have you willingly surrendered to God? What areas may still need to bow before Him? Write honestly and prayerfully.
Closing Prayer: Jesus, thank You for the grace that invites me to bow willingly now. Strengthen me to surrender what I wrote about today. Amen.
Day 3 — Letting God Be the Judge
Opening Prayer: Lord, calm my spirit and remove any desire to control or judge others. Give me humility as I reflect. Amen.
Journal Prompt: Are there people or situations where you have taken on the role of judge? How does Romans 14:11 remind you to release that burden?
Closing Prayer: Gracious God, teach me to trust Your judgment. Help me walk in humility, grace, and compassion. Amen.
Day 4 — Living in Awe
Opening Prayer: Father, awaken holy awe within me today. Help me see Your majesty and respond with worship. Amen.
Journal Prompt: Imagine the moment when every knee bows and every tongue confesses God. How does this picture stir your heart? What does it inspire in you?
Closing Prayer: Lord, let Your greatness be the lens through which I see everything. Keep my heart rooted in worship. Amen.
Day 5 — Examining Personal Alignment
Opening Prayer: Lord, search my heart gently today. Reveal where my life is aligned with You and where it is not. Amen.
Journal Prompt: If your life were examined today, would it reflect someone already bowed before God? What changes or growth would help you better embody this posture?
Closing Prayer: God, thank You for Your patience with me. Shape me into someone who honors You in all things. Amen.
Day 6 — Confidence in God’s Justice
Opening Prayer: Righteous God, bring peace to my soul today as I rest in Your justice and Your perfect timing. Amen.
Journal Prompt: Where have you struggled with unanswered justice? How does knowing God will have the final word bring comfort, clarity, or hope?
Closing Prayer: Lord, I entrust every injustice into Your hands. Help me walk in peace, knowing You see all and rule over all. Amen.
Day 7 — Living for the Eternal King
Opening Prayer: King of all, meet me here in this quiet moment. Help me set my mind on eternity and live faithfully today. Amen.
Journal Prompt: What does it look like to live daily for the King whose glory all creation will one day acknowledge? What practices, attitudes, or habits will help you walk this out?
Closing Prayer: Father, thank You for this week of reflection. Seal these truths in my heart and teach me to live each day in joyful surrender to Your Lordship. Amen.
